4. Agent builds the map (reasoning — no script)
Read the inventories, subtopics, and probes, then:
- classify your + competitor pages into topics; flag thin/outdated/orphan pages;
- semantically cluster the subtopic universe (shared root, intent, hierarchy);
- design the pillar→cluster→supporting tree per target topic, assign content type + word-count target, and lay out internal links (pillar↔clusters, cluster↔cluster, supporting→clusters) with specific anchor text;
- build the coverage gap matrix (subtopic × your content × each competitor × volume × difficulty → gap flag) and priority-score each piece (volume 25%, competitive gap 25%, intent 20%, cluster completeness 15%, effort 15%);
- sequence the calendar against
content_capacity(front-load pillars before clusters).

Notes & edge cases
- Authority is depth, not breadth — the interlinked architecture + anchor-text plan is the value and is fully keyless; only per-subtopic volume granularity degrades without a paid API.
- Autocomplete is the keyword primitive — lean on
expand_keywords.pybefore any paid API. - Mark volumes as directional when no keyword API is connected; prioritize on competitive-gap + intent rather than raw volume in that case.
- Calendar is capacity-bound — never schedule more pieces/month than
